reactjs - reactReduxFirebase 未定义
问题描述
我正在使用 reactReduxFirebase 对用户进行身份验证。这是我用来创建商店的代码。
import { reactReduxFirebase } from "react-redux-firebase";
import firebase from "./services/firebase";
const createStoreWithFirebase = compose(reactReduxFirebase(firebase))(
createStore
);
const store = createStoreWithFirebase(
reducers,
{},
applyMiddleware(reduxThunk)
);
当记录的 reactReduxFirebase 未定义并且我收到时,撰写会引发错误。
TypeError: Object(...) is not a function
解决方案
这很可能是因为您使用的是 react-redux-firebase 版本 3,您无法再从中导入reactReduxFirebase
.
通过在终端中键入以下内容,尝试安装旧版本的软件包:
npm i react-redux-firebase@2.2.4
推荐阅读
- javascript - 获取数据的函数保持循环运行
- apache-kafka - kafka中异步发送的确认模式有什么影响?
- r - 查找最早的间隔开始日期并提取间隔(R,lubridate)
- ios - 在iOS上显示键盘后如何固定标题?
- sql - 如何使用 oracle sql 删除列中的 _step
- php - 如何在 Mockery 中正确模拟界面?
- azure - 在进行蓝绿部署时,Azure 上的实时连接是否断开
- reactjs - webpack v4 在生产模式下如何处理 devDependencies?
- multithreading - DLL_PROCESS_DETACH 只剩下一个线程
- php - 如何在正则表达式中跳过某些内容?